
This Wednesday (on March 23, 2011),
CDNetworks, which is highest performing global content delivery network (CDN),
announced that it will offer free website delivery to the Japanese Government and the other non-government organizations that work for providing relief to the Japan’s earthquake crisis.
The earthquake in Japan had not only rendered many websites losing control due to infrastructure unavailability, but also some of these websites went down due to the huge amounts of traffic that tried to get more information about the situation. To support these websites in reaching out to more people and effectively providing information about relief, CDNetworks has decided to provide its services for these websites to remain up and running. This is part of CDNetworks effort to help the recovery effort from the aftermath of the Japanese earthquake.
For availing support of CDNetworks’ global CDN, the Government and NGO personnel just need to contact the CDNetworks’ Japan Office in Tokyo, and the CDN provider would help in taking care of the rest of the information to provide high performance and scalable content delivery.
